If you're looking for a Central Florida venue to accommodate at most 250 guests, look no further! The Dr. Phillips House offers an amazing Victorian charm with both inside and outside locations. Kasi and her girls spent the morning getting ready in the bridal suite while Leland and the guys enjoyed the wine cellar downstairs. The garden has a great set-up for the ceremony and cocktail hour followed by dinner inside the house, moving the party back outside again to the open-floor plan! The couple chose not to see each other before the ceremony, which made the ceremony more special as Kasi made her entrance down the garden staircase!


Guests arrived through the entrance of the Victorian house, signing the guest book and looking over the table assignments as they made their way to the back of house entering the garden ceremony. After they said their vowels and "I Do's" the couple took photos around the gorgeous property while guests enjoyed cocktails and hor d'oeuvres throughout the garden area. The venue makes a quick and seamless transition removing the chairs and accommodating high tops for cocktail hour. I was making sure the details in the dining room were perfect during this time. Tables were dressed in soft white linen, with soft florals and standing table numbers. Wine and gold were the accent colors carried out through the napkins, floral centerpieces and votive candles.


The newlyweds entered the dining room to celebrate with their closest family and friends! The bridal party and family members gave meaningful toasts followed by a buffet styled dinner. After some mingling and cake cutting, the reception continued outside in the garden where the couple shared their first dance under the beautiful garden lights! During this time, I made sure the dining room was cleaned up and organized. I ensured the couples DIY décor and belongings were packed up properly and the venue was cleaned at the end of the night.


The couple was staying on-site at the Dr. Phillips House that night. With the venue centered in the heart of Orlando, the newlyweds and bridal party continued their celebration with a night out in Downtown Orlando.
